About 2,4-dimethyl-5-(1-methylcyclopentyl)-1,3-thiazole
2,4-dimethyl-5-(1-methylcyclopentyl)-1,3-thiazole (PubChem CID 146290468) has the molecular formula C11H17NS
and a molecular weight of 195.33 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2,4-dimethyl-5-(1-methylcyclopentyl)-1,3-thiazole.
